FanDuel has an employee rating of 3.8 out of 5 stars, based on 747 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The FanDuel employ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Arts, Entertainment & Recreation industry (3.9 stars).

Pros

As this happens to most start ups, FanDuel went through the hyper growth phase which makes it a very unique place to work. The disruptive environment opens up so many opportunities for growth and creativity. With all the unforeseen shifts in the market your role requires you to challenge yourselves in ways you never have before and elevate your skill set to the next level. FanDuel offers so much more than your basic benefits. Unlimited vacation and flexible work from home days are such great advantages for employees with family responsibilities. Fully stocked kitchen with plenty of snack options, weekly happy hours, game tickets and discounts on gym memberships are just a few other perks.

Cons

The two main offices are located in Edinburgh and New York.. The time zones and cultural differences can sometimes be challenging in communication.

Pros

The people at FanDuel are genuinely talented and supportive. Collaboration is strong, the energy is high, and teams consistently deliver high-quality work under demanding timelines. There’s a real sense of camaraderie that makes the day-to-day experience fulfilling.

Cons

Employee Relations is, without question, the most concerning part of working at FanDuel. Their approach is rigid, punitive, and disconnected from the reality of how teams operate. Rather than supporting employees or resolving issues, ER often feels focused on punishment over fairness. There is little room for dialogue, context, or proportionality. Even minor, unintentional mistakes can result in extreme consequences delivered without warning. Decisions feel opaque and predetermined, with no meaningful opportunity to be heard or course-correct. “Consistency and fairness” is frequently cited, but in practice it comes across as a way to avoid nuance or accountability. The result is a culture of fear that discourages openness, undermines trust, and makes employees feel disposable.
